Ondo Finance Unveils Execution Network as Next Evolution of Ondo Chain

Ondo Finance has unveiled a new infrastructure layer known as the Ondo Network, positioning it as the natural progression of its earlier blockchain concept, Ondo Chain. The company describes the network as an execution environment tailored for modern financial markets, delivering the rapid processing and confidentiality associated with traditional centralized platforms while retaining blockchain-style verifiability and allowing users to maintain control of their own assets.

The system is already operational. Its debut application is Ondo Perps, a high-performance perpetual futures venue that went live shortly before the network announcement.

Officials emphasize that the infrastructure is not limited to derivatives.

It is designed as general-purpose technology capable of supporting spot trading, lending products, structured instruments, and other applications that require fast, private, and independently checkable computation.

The shift away from a conventional blockchain stems from lessons learned during the development of Ondo Perps and conversations with clients.

The team concluded that the primary constraint for competitive trading systems is execution rather than settlement.

Traditional blockchains typically combine execution, verification, and final settlement on a single shared ledger.

While this design delivers strong durability and trust, it also introduces latency and forces transparency that can hinder high-frequency or sensitive trading activity.

Ondo Network addresses the issue by separating these functions.

Application logic runs inside secure hardware enclaves, also called trusted execution environments.

These isolated environments process matching, margin calculations, and liquidations at speeds comparable to centralized exchanges and keep the activity private by default.

A decentralized group of attestors cryptographically confirms that only previously reviewed and approved code is running inside each enclave.

The attestors also hold fragmented cryptographic keys so that no single party can alter the software or move user funds unilaterally.

Final asset transfers settle on public blockchains, beginning with Ethereum, with plans to expand support and eventually commit settled state records on-chain for added durability.

This architecture aims to deliver several practical advantages: near-real-time performance without forcing every step through network-wide consensus, default privacy for sensitive order flow and positions, independent verifiability through signed execution logs that third parties can replay, and a non-custodial model in which users retain ownership of their assets.

Future upgrades may include a broader and more open attestor set, external watchers, additional cryptographic proofs, and progressive decentralization measures.

Company leadership frames the Ondo Network not as a replacement that discards prior work, but as a clearer realization of the original goals behind Ondo Chain.

The earlier vision sought infrastructure that would make institutional-grade markets more open and efficient.

By focusing specifically on the execution bottleneck and leveraging specialized hardware together with distributed attestation, the team believes it has produced a more practical solution that still preserves the core benefits of blockchain technology.

The launch underscores Ondo’s broader overall strategy of letting product requirements guide technical choices rather than treating any single technology as an end in itself. As the network matures and attracts more participants, the distinction between this specialized execution layer and a traditional blockchain may continue to blur, potentially expanding the range of financial applications that can operate at institutional speed while remaining transparent and user-controlled.
